Transaction 768a8e21872bc2106bf5e49734334568b12002c047b1763061a62442438806ed

1 Input
2 Outputs
  • 768a8e21872bc2106bf5e49734334568b12002c047b1763061a62442438806ed:0
  • value  1000000
    address  mhkSdfTuiNnwwT9FPMdz48hFfQNpVVNA8h
  • 768a8e21872bc2106bf5e49734334568b12002c047b1763061a62442438806ed:1
  • value  3099832
    address  2NBf4sacrYSgh6t3EEficEz1Ko7rkd43zeZ